The Michelin Guide's review
The wide, deep gorges carved out by the Umzinkulwana River are part of a reserve. The thick forests, rocky walls and waterfalls have created a rugged landscape that is rare in this region where sugarcane and seaside resorts have taken over. For a nice view, check out Camel Rock, Oriki Heads and Horseshoe Rock.
